Prerequisites:

Dogs must be one year of age and in your home for one year prior to the Pet Partner evaluation.  Other domestic pets are welcome (ie: rabbits, cats, rats, birds).  We recommend a recent obedience course with your dog in preparation for the Pet Partner Workshop.  This is a good way to “predict” your dog’s behavior with people and other dogs, prior to the Pet Partner Evaluation.

Goal:

Maintain standards of professionalism for the field of animal-assisted activities (AAA) and animal-assisted therapy (AAT); helping AAA & AAT to become widely recognized as valuable forms of treatment.

Activity objectives:

Upon completion of this program, the healthcare professional will:

Describe the impact and benefits AAA and AAT on the patient and when it is appropriate to set goals for the plan of care.

Locate resources and science referencing Pet Partner visits, the human/animal bond and how this affects your patients.

Review questions/concerns of administrators and staff regarding infection control, animal behavior and responsibilities of the handler while in the healthcare facility.
